Classy spot in the Michelin Guide. A local business professionals spot after work. My favorite aspect is the outside lounge tables and cushioned chairs with gas fireplaces right on the capitol mall under the trees. Beware if you hate crows.

A really cool wide open restaurant with a wonderful staff and broad menu. We tried the meat pie - too much crust and not enough meat inside. The bread rolls looked great but had no bread on inside so probably overcooked. The gravy and potatoes were really good. Sausage roll app not worth it, however the tuna tartar was excellent. Steaks were good but pricey and the wine list has great selection.
